4imprint (PPAI 107200, Platinum) – ranked the No. 1 distributor in the inaugural PPAI 100 – earned $1.33 billion in revenue last year, according to its just-released 2023 final financial results report.

  • It’s the highest revenue report for a distributor that the promotional products industry has ever seen.
  • The final report confirms 4imprint’s preliminary results, which were announced in a trading update the day after The PPAI Expo 2024 ended.


The Wisconsin-based company's annual revenue was up $186 million over 2022, equating to a 16% uptick from one calendar year to the next. The firm’s operating profit for 2023 climbed 32% to $136 million and its profit before tax was $140.7 million, compared to $104 million in 2022.

Financial Titan

This report is believed to have significantly widened the gulf over all other promo distributors in terms of reported revenue.

4imprint’s digital-first approach, which largely eliminates the need for individual salespeople, has long been a disruptive force in promo.


However, the company’s greatest strength may be its marketing efforts. As the industry’s largest advertiser, 4imprint is the closest thing to a household name distributor among end-buyers, and its campaigns undoubtedly help keep promo top of mind for the greater public.

  • 4imprint received more than two million total orders in 2023, up 12% from 2022, and acquired 311,000 new customers, up 1.3% from 2022, according to the report.
